What is a Sauna Room?
A sauna room is a small, enclosed space designed for heat sessions, typically ranging in temperature from 150°F to 195°F (65°C to 90°C). Saunas are used for relaxation, detoxification, and various health benefits such as improved circulation and muscle relaxation. The high heat induces sweating, which helps cleanse the skin and body.
Understanding Sauna Lighting Requirements
When selecting lighting for a sauna, it's essential to consider specific requirements to ensure safety, functionality, and a pleasant ambiance. Here are the key factors to consider.
1) Heat Resistance
Choosing lights made from materials that can withstand high temperatures is crucial. Look for products specifically designed for sauna use, ensuring they won't degrade or malfunction due to the heat.

2) Waterproof and Moisture Resistance
Lights should have a high Ingress Protection (IP) rating, indicating their resistance to water and moisture. This ensures they will perform reliably in the humid environment of a sauna.
3) Light Color and Intensity
The color and brightness of the lights can significantly impact the sauna experience. Warm, dimmable lights are often preferred for relaxation, while brighter, cooler lights may be better for visibility. Some modern lighting systems offer adjustable colors and brightness levels to suit different preferences.
4) Dimmability
Dimmable lights allow users to adjust the brightness to their liking, creating the perfect ambiance for relaxation or visibility. This feature adds versatility and enhances the overall sauna experience.
Types of Sauna Lights
Incandescent Sauna Lights
Incandescent lights produce a warm, inviting glow and are known for their affordability and simplicity. However, they consume more energy and have a shorter lifespan compared to modern lighting options. They are best suited for creating a cozy ambiance but may not be the most efficient choice for long-term use in saunas.
LED Sauna Lights

LED lights are highly energy-efficient and have a long lifespan, making them a cost-effective option. They are available in various colors and can be customized to suit different moods and preferences. LEDs generate less heat, which is advantageous in the already hot environment of a sauna.
Fiber Optic Sauna Lights
Fiber optic lighting is an excellent choice for saunas due to its safety and aesthetic appeal. The light source is located outside the sauna, with fibers transmitting light into the room. This setup eliminates electrical components inside the sauna, reducing the risk of heat damage and electrical hazards.
Halogen Sauna Lights
Halogen lights are a type of incandescent light that is more energy-efficient and produces a bright, white light. They are durable and can withstand high temperatures, making them suitable for saunas. However, they generate more heat and consume more energy than LEDs.

Choosing the Right Color Temperature

For most home saunas aimed at relaxation and comfort, warm light (2700K - 3000K) is generally the best choice. This color temperature produces a soft, yellowish glow that closely resembles the gentle light of a sunset or candlelight. Such lighting helps create a peaceful and inviting environment, which is essential for fostering relaxation and tranquility.

Where to Install The Lights in a Sauna or Steam Room
When designing the lighting for a sauna or steam room, it's important to create a balance between functionality and ambiance. Proper lighting enhances the overall experience by providing visibility while maintaining a relaxing atmosphere. Here are some key areas to consider for light installation:
Ceiling Lights
Installing lights on the ceiling can provide even illumination throughout the sauna. It's essential to position them in a way that avoids direct glare while ensuring adequate lighting.
Wall-Mounted Lights
Wall-mounted lights are ideal for illuminating specific areas, such as benches or entranceways. Placing them at an appropriate height ensures they provide sufficient light without causing discomfort to users.
Under-Bench Lighting

Under-bench lighting creates a soft, ambient glow that enhances the relaxing atmosphere of the sauna. It also helps illuminate the lower part of the sauna, improving visibility and safety.
Backrest and Corner
Lighting Installing lights behind backrests or in corners can add a subtle, indirect light source that enhances the ambiance without being too harsh. This type of lighting is perfect for creating a cozy, inviting environment.
Entrance and Exit Areas
Proper lighting near doors is crucial for safety, ensuring that users can see clearly when entering or exiting the sauna. This helps prevent accidents and enhances the overall usability of the sauna.
Installation Tips and Considerations
Location and Placement
Carefully consider the placement of lights to ensure even illumination and avoid glare. Lights should be positioned away from direct steam and water exposure to prolong their lifespan.
Wiring and Electrical Safety
Use heat-resistant wiring designed for high-temperature environments. It's essential to follow electrical safety guidelines and consult with a professional electrician to ensure a safe installation.
DIY vs Professional Installation
DIY installation can save money, but professional installation ensures compliance with safety standards and optimal placement. Consider the complexity of the installation and your skill level before deciding.
FAQs
1. Can I use any type of light bulb in my sauna?
No, you should only use light bulbs specifically designed for sauna environments. Regular bulbs may not withstand the high temperatures and humidity levels of a sauna, potentially leading to safety hazards and reduced lifespan.
2. What is the ideal wattage for sauna lights?
The ideal wattage depends on the size of your sauna and the type of lighting used. Generally, lower wattage bulbs (e.g., 15-40 watts) are sufficient for providing soft, ambient lighting without generating excessive heat.
3. Are colored lights beneficial in a sauna?
Yes, colored lights can enhance the sauna experience by creating different moods and atmospheres. Many people use colored LED lights for chromotherapy, which involves using different colors to promote physical and mental well-being.

4. How can I prevent my sauna lights from flickering?
Flickering lights can be caused by various issues, including loose connections, faulty wiring, or incompatible bulbs. Ensure all electrical connections are secure, use heat-resistant wiring, and choose bulbs that are compatible with your lighting fixtures.
5. Is it necessary to have multiple light sources in a sauna?
Having multiple light sources can enhance the overall lighting and ambiance of your sauna. For example, combining ceiling lights, wall-mounted lights, and under-bench lighting can create a more balanced and inviting environment.
6. Can I use smart lighting systems in my sauna?
Smart lighting systems can be used in saunas, provided they are designed to withstand high temperatures and humidity. These systems offer remote control and customization options, enhancing the convenience and experience of your sauna sessions.
7. What safety precautions should I take when installing sauna lights?
Ensure all electrical work complies with local safety standards and regulations. Use heat-resistant and waterproof materials, and consider hiring a professional electrician for installation. Regularly inspect your lighting system for any signs of damage or wear.
8. How can I enhance the ambiance of my sauna with lighting?
Enhance the ambiance by using a combination of warm, dimmable lights, and colored LED strips. Strategically place lights under benches, behind backrests, and in corners to create a soft, inviting glow that enhances relaxation.
9. What should I do if my sauna lights stop working?
If your sauna lights stop working, first check for any obvious issues like blown fuses or tripped breakers. Ensure all connections are secure and inspect bulbs for signs of damage. If the problem persists, consult a professional electrician to diagnose and fix the issue.
